Fixture Analysis and Scheduling Considerations
Understanding the fixture calendar is fundamental to implementing effective fantasy football strategies. The fantasy football tips UK leagues focus update places significant emphasis on identifying periods when your selected players face favourable matchups. Double gameweeks and blank gameweeks require special attention, as they can dramatically impact your squad’s performance.
Defensive selections deserve particular focus during fixture analysis. Identifying teams with upcoming runs of matches against lower-scoring opponents can provide consistent point accumulation. Similarly, attacking players facing weak defences represent premium opportunities for capitalising on bonus points and clean sheet bonuses.
Captaincy decisions warrant careful consideration based on fixture analysis. The fantasy football tips UK leagues focus update recommends assessing not just the opponent’s defensive record but also the specific matchup dynamics, player form, and potential for attacking returns. Your captain choice can significantly amplify or diminish your gameweek score.

Form Analysis and Player Selection
Current form represents one of the most tangible metrics for player selection. The fantasy football tips UK leagues focus update emphasises distinguishing between temporary form dips and genuine performance concerns. Statistical analysis of expected goals and expected assists can reveal whether poor returns reflect bad luck or declining quality.
Player consistency matters more than occasional explosive performances. Identifying players who deliver reliable point accumulation week after week provides a stable foundation for your squad. The fantasy football tips UK leagues focus update recommends focusing on players with high floor values rather than chasing ceiling potential exclusively.
